    BotKube Reviews
    BotKube is an automated messaging bot that monitors and debugs Kubernetes clusters. InfraCloud developed and maintains it. BotKube is compatible with many messaging platforms such as Slack, Mattermost and Microsoft Teams. It can help you monitor your Kubernetes clusters, debug critical deployments, and give recommendations for best practices. BotKube monitors Kubernetes resources, and sends a notification via the channel if an event occurs such as ImagePullBackOff error. You can set the objects and the level of events that you want from the Kubernetes Cluster. You can toggle on/off notifications. BotKube can execute Kubectl commands on Kubernetes clusters without access to Kubeconfig and underlying infrastructure. BotKube allows you to debug your cluster's deployment, services, or any other aspect of it from your messaging window.

    Stetho Reviews
    Stetho is an advanced debug bridge for Android apps. Developers have native access to the Chrome Developer Tools feature as part of the Chrome desktop browser. Developers have the option to enable dumpapp, which provides a powerful command line interface to application internals. You can also include Stetho via Maven Central via Gradle, Maven. You only need the main Stetho dependency, but you may also want to use one or more of the network helpers. Integration with the Chrome DevTools frontend can be done using a client/server protocol that the Stetho software provides for you. The full range of Chrome Developer Tools features are available, including image preview, JSON response assisters, and exporting traces in the HAR format. SQLite databases can interactively be visualized and explored with full read/write capabilities.

    GDB Reviews
    GDB, the GNU Project Debugger, allows you see what's going on "inside" another program as it executes. It also lets you see what another program was doing when it crashed. Start your program and specify any changes that could affect its behavior. When your program stops, examine what has happened. You can make changes to your program so that you can try out different bugs and learn more about them. These programs could be running on the same machine that GDB (native), another machine (remote), and on a simulator. GDB is compatible with most UNIX and Microsoft Windows versions, as well Mac OS X.

    GNU DDD Reviews
    GNU DDD is a graphical interface for command-line debuggers like GDBX, DBX and WDB. DDD is known for its interactive graphical data display. Data structures are displayed in graphs and it has other features than the usual front-end features. The FSF shop sells software that supports the principle of software independence. You will need the GNU Debugger (GDB), version 4.16 (or, depending on the program being debugged, other command-line debuggers like Ladebug, JDB or XDB), or the Perl debugger and bash debugger bashdb or the GNU Make debugger remake or the Python debugger pydb.

    weinre Reviews

    weinre

    Apache Software Foundation

    WEb INspector REmote is WEinre Pronounced like "winery". Or perhaps like the word "weiner". Weinre is a web page debugger, similar to FireBug (for Firefox), and Web Inspector (for WebKit based browsers), but it's designed to work remotely and, in particular, to allow users to debug web pages from a mobile device like a phone. Weinre was created in an era when there weren't any remote debuggers for mobile devices. Some platforms have begun to offer remote debugging capabilities as part of their platform toolkit. Weinre uses the user interface code from WebKit's web inspector project. If you have used Chrome's Developer Tools or Safari's web inspector, you will be familiar with weinre. Normal usage will require you to run the client application on your desktop/laptop and a target page on your smartphone. Weinre doesn't use any 'native code' in the browser. It's just plain old JavaScript.

    Orbit Profiler Reviews

    Orbit Profiler

    Orbit Profiler

    Find performance bottlenecks quickly and visualize what's going on in complex C/C++ applications. Orbit is an independent profiler and debugging software for Windows and Linux. Its primary purpose is to assist developers in understanding and visualizing the execution flow of complex applications. Orbit provides a bird's-eye view of what's happening under the hood. This allows developers to better understand complex systems and quickly identify performance bottlenecks. Orbit will work on any C/C++ program, as long as the application has access to a Pdb file. As soon as Orbit is downloaded, you can start profiling. Orbit injects and hooks selected functions into the target process. It works on highly optimized final/shipping build. When you don't have a clue where to begin, sampling is a great way to get started. Orbit's sampler is fast, robust and "always-on". Orbit optimizes the workflow by combining dynamic instrumentation and sampling.

    VisualVM Reviews
    VisualVM monitors, troubleshoots, and diagnoses Java 1.4+ applications from a variety of vendors using jvmstat (jvmstat.com), JMX (Serviceability Agent), and Attach API. VisualVM is designed to meet the needs of all application developers, system administrators and quality engineers. VisualVM displays basic runtime information for each process: PID, mainclass, arguments passed to the java process, JVM home, JVM arguments and flags, and System properties. VisualVM monitors CPU usage of the application, GC activity and heap and metaspace / permanent memory, as well as the number of loaded classes, and running threads. VisualVM provides basic profiler capabilities to analyze application performance and memory management. Both sampling and instrumentation profiles are available.
